Abstract
Deaths of young women due to autoerotic asphyxia have been rarely reported. The case of a 19-year-old woman is described in which several of the characteristic death-scene features found in cases of male autoerotic asphyxial deaths were absent. An awareness that this syndrome may occur among women with a less obvious presentation than in men is essential so that death will not be incorrectly attributed to nonaccidental causes. This syndrome may be more common than the number of reported cases would suggest.Entities:
